Webb1 jan. 2024 · Biochemical Recurrence without Metastatic Disease after Exhaustion of Local Treatment Options After local therapy including surgery or radiation, the first sign of recurrence is typically a rising prostate specific antigen … WebbHormone therapy is sometimes recommended for men who have a "biochemical" recurrence —a rise in prostate-specific antigen (PSA) level following primary local treatment with surgery or radiation—especially if the PSA level doubles in fewer than 3 months. Webb16 feb. 2024 · A transrectal biopsy is used to diagnose prostate cancer. A transrectal biopsy is the removal of tissue from the prostate by inserting a thin needle through the rectum and into the prostate. This procedure may be done using transrectal ultrasound or transrectal MRI to help guide where samples of tissue are taken from.
